
Stay Toasty at Night with a Heated Mattress Pad
When nighttime temperatures start to fall, it is time
to get out the flannel sheets and the extra blankets. But did you know
that there is another way to stay cozy on a cold winter night, without
adding extra weight and bulk to your bed covers? The answer is a heated
mattress pad that will heat your sheets from the bottom up and help you
sleep in comfort throughout the winter months.
While heated mattress pads tend to cost a bit more than their standard
counterparts, the warm nights of rest that you enjoy will be worth every
extra penny spent! The other advantage to a heated mattress pad is that
if you sleep on a bed larger than a twin, you can control each side of
the pad separately. That translates into a comfortable bed for two, even
if one of you likes much more warmth than the other.
Benefits Of Heated Mattress Pad
Not only are heated mattress pads great for keeping you warm, they can
also be very soothing for tired and aching muscles. Insomnia has become
a major problem in this country in recent years, and much of the sleep
trouble has been attributed to aches and pains that are severe enough to
keep us awake at night.
By adding a little bit of heat to where you lie down at night, you can
help sore joints and muscles to relax, making rest come a little bit
easier. There is also the comforting effect of snuggling into a bed that
has already been warmed to an optimum temperature. This can make you
relax as efficiently as a glass of warm milk or a hot bath at bedtime!
Time To Shop For Heated Mattress Pad
Heated mattress pads come in a broad range of quality and style. The
level of quality will not only affect the pad itself, but also the
heater that goes into keeping the pad warm. To ensure that you are
getting a good heater for your mattress pad, look for a longer warranty
by the manufacturer. Long warranties are generally only offered on
higher quality mattress pads.
You can also look for a pad that is offered under the name of a
well-known manufacturer, since these generally tend to be better quality
as well. You also want to feel the pad before purchasing it to be sure
that the fabric is soft and the heating coils are well cushioned inside
of the pad so that they don’t disturb you while you are sleeping.
Once you have come to a decision on the heated mattress pad that you
want to purchase, take some time to shop at the various retailers that
include bedding stores, discount chains and websites to hunt for the
best price. Heated mattress pads have a competitive market, so shopping
around may be well worth your effort. Once you have purchased your
heated mattress pad, enjoy the warm nights of sleep that will be yours
with a simple click of a button. Good night! |
